Maritime cop fatally shot outside his house

A POLICE officer assigned in the Maritime Group was gunned down in front of his house in Barangay Babag, Lapu-Lapu City last Friday night, May 3.

Investigators from the Hoopsdome Police Station identified the victim as Police Master Sergeant Joseph Villamor.

Police Master Sergeant Rudy Janagap of the Hoopsdome Police Station told SunStar Cebu and Superbalita Cebu that Villamor was standing outside his house and talking to someone when two unidentified men on board a black and yellow scooter suddenly approached him at 7:57 p.m.

One of the two men, identified as the passenger, suddenly pulled out his pistol and shot Villamor in the head once.

After Villamor fell on the ground, the gunman fired several shots at the police officer before the gunman and his companion fled to an unknown direction.

Villamor died instantly.

Police found eight empty shells from a .45 pistol at the scene.

Jaganap said Villamor worked as an intelligence officer assigned in various PNP Maritime Units in the Visayas.

Before his assignment at the PNP Maritime Group, Villamor worked for the Lapu-Lapu City Intelligence Branch from 2014 to 2015.

Jaganap said Villamor recently returned home as he was scheduled to attend a hearing at the Lapu-Lapu City Palace of Justice next week.

Villamor is survived by his wife, Police Master Sergeant Laila Samson Villamor, who is assigned at the Police Regional Office (PRO) 7.

Jaganap said they still had no idea who was behind Villamor’s murder.

In a separate interview, Police Chief Master Sergeant Mer Acebron of the Lapu-Lapu City Police Office said they would check if Villamor’s killers were caught on security cameras in the area.

Acebron said there was a possibility that Villamor’s murder was related to his work.

Although the slain police officer never mentioned any threats to his life to his family, there might have been people out there who wanted him dead because of his work as an intelligence officer, he said.

Acebron said he had heard rumors linking Villamor to the illegal drug trade and to retired PRO 7 director Marcelo Garbo, whom President Rodrigo Duterte had named a drug protector.

“Wala man mi idea pa na-involve ba ni sa drugas kay amo imbetigasyon padayon pa gyud. Di pud mi kasulti pa ana mga taho nga driver siya kaniadto ni Garbo (We have no idea if he was involved in illegal drugs since our investigation is still ongoing. We also can’t comment on rumors that he was connected to Garbo),” Acebron added. (from FVQ, GCM of SuperBalita Cebu/JKV)
